Research Interests

  • My research interest is the mechanisms of the development of the digestive system neoplasms, including hepatocellular carcinogenesis (HCC) and pancreatic cancer, from the aspect of cellular basic biological function regulation and also combined with the microenvironment or systematic clues. We preferred to study the mechanisms from aspects of cell cycle, cell mitosis, nucleolar function and microenvironment inputs. Our research articles were published in Gastroenterology, Journal of Hepatology, Cancer Research and et al.

  • One of our main findings is to report the role of RacGAP1 in mediating cell cytokinesis in HCC and reveal new RacGAP1 dependent molecular links between cytokinesis and the Hippo pathway. As cytokinesis failure was tolerant in normal hepatocytes, strategies that blocking cancer cell cytokinesis might be promising in HCC treatment. Recently, we are interested in exploring mechanisms that specifically regulate cytokinesis and revealing their function in liver function and liver diseases. We are also interested in seeking important players that regulate nucleolar function and nuclear architecture to coordinate with cell cycle progress and microenvironment stress in cancers.
